China context

In China's strategic timeline, the 2027 centenary goal serves as an important intermediate stepping stone toward basic military modernization by 2035 and building a world-class military by mid-century. The commentary reinforces Party authority and Xi Jinping's leadership over the armed forces ahead of the landmark anniversary.

Ahead of the People's Liberation Army's (PLA) 99th founding anniversary on August 1, official Chinese state media outlets—including China Military Online and People's Daily—published a commentary urging service members to focus on combat readiness and fulfilling long-term modernization targets. The commentary, authored by Zhang Shunliang in the People's Daily edition, framed the 99th anniversary as an important milestone for the final push toward the military's centenary anniversary on August 1, 2027. The publication stressed that reaching the 2027 centenary goal for military development has now entered a "critical period." Describing this milestone as a historical responsibility that the armed forces must deliver on, the text called on troops stationed at border defense posts, naval units conducting deep-sea patrols, and air defense forces guarding national airspace to remain at high readiness and prioritize practical combat capabilities. Highlighting the strategic imperatives driving defense work, the commentary quoted Chinese President and Central Military Commission Chairman Xi Jinping as stating, "the greater the cause, the more it is filled with challenges, and the more necessary it is to bear heavy responsibilities." State media noted that the security environment facing China's military on this journey is becoming increasingly severe, with strategic tasks becoming more arduous and demanding. To navigate these challenges, the article instructed military personnel regardless of their role or position to integrate ideological loyalty with concrete performance. Emphasizing rigorous training, practical execution, and overcoming technical or operational difficulties, the text maintained that the best way to honor historical anniversaries is to focus single-mindedly on uncompleted military objectives as the PLA approaches its 100th anniversary.
